Educational Pathways to Become a Registered Nurse in 2024
1.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N)
The BSN degree remains the most recognized and comprehensive pathway for aspiring RNs. It typically takes about 3-4 years to complete and offers extensive clinical training, leadership skills, and research knowledge essential for advanced nursing roles.
- Prerequisites: High school diploma or equivalent, science courses (biology, chemistry, anatomy).
- Key Features: In-depth coursework, practical clinical experience, and internship opportunities.
- Advantages: Better job prospects, higher earning potential, eligibility for advanced roles.
2.Accelerated Bachelor’s Degree Programs
If you already hold a bachelor’s degree in another field, accelerated BSN programs in 2024 allow completion within 12-18 months. These are intensive and designed for motivated individuals seeking a quick transition into nursing.
- Prerequisites: Bachelor’s degree in a non-nursing field, science prerequisites completed.
- Benefits: Fast-track your nursing career without starting from scratch.
3.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N)
The ADN program typically takes 2-3 years and is a popular choice for practical entry into nursing, especially in community colleges. While slightly more limited than BSN in scope,it still qualifies graduates for RN licensing and bedside care roles.
- Advantages: Lower cost, shorter duration, quick entry into the workforce.
- Considerations: Might limit advancement opportunities compared to BSN.
4. LPN to RN Bridge Programs
Licensed Practical Nurses (LPNs) can enhance their qualifications through LPN to RN bridge programs in 2024, which allow LPNs to become RNs with additional training in a shorter time frame.
Practical Training and Clinical Experience
Hands-on clinical experience is integral to nursing education. Most programs incorporate simulation labs, hospital rotations, and community health settings to ensure students are prepared for real-world scenarios.Here’s what to expect:
- Clinical Hours: Typically 500-1000 hours, depending on the program.
- Specializations: Pediatrics, geriatrics, emergency care, mental health, and more.
- skills growth: Patient assessment, critical thinking, interaction, and teamwork.
Licensing and Certification
Upon completing an approved nursing program, graduates must pass the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X-RN) to become licensed registered nurses.In 2024, the NCLEX continues to be the gold standard for assessing nursing competence against industry standards.

Practical Tips for Aspiring Nurses in 2024
- Research accreditation: Ensure your chosen program is accredited by relevant bodies like ACEN or CCNE.
- Gain relevant experience: Volunteer or work as a caregiver to build practical skills and confidence.
- Prepare for licensing exams: Use practice tests, study groups, and online resources.
- Network: Join professional nursing associations and attend industry events to connect with mentors and employers.
- Stay updated: Keep abreast of healthcare advancements and policy changes affecting nursing practice.
